Amplify Your Reach: Choosing the Best Music Distributor for You

Embarking on your musical journey requires finding the perfect platform to launch your creations with the world. A music distributor acts as your conduit to major streaming services, online stores, and playlists. But with a plethora of platforms available, choosing the right one can feel overwhelming.

  • Leading consider your objectives. Are you aiming for worldwide exposure or concentrating a specific niche?
  • Then, evaluate the services each distributor provides. Some highlight in specific genres, while others provide full-fledged packages.
  • Lastly, compare the earnings models. Understand how each distributor pays artists and determines royalties.

By carefully considering these factors, you can pinpoint the music distributor that perfectly aligns with your artistic vision and long-term goals.

Breakthrough Barriers: Mastering Music Distribution in 2023

The music industry continues to shift at a rapid pace. Aspiring artists now have unprecedented opportunities to reach global audiences, thanks to the ever-expanding world of digital music distribution. However, navigating this landscape can feel overwhelming. With countless platforms and strategies vying for attention, it's crucial to develop a savvy approach to ensure your music hits its intended audience.

One key factor of successful distribution is selecting the ideal platforms for your genre and target market. Research diverse options, from established giants like Spotify and Apple Music to niche platforms catering to particular musical tastes.

Consider factors such as royalty rates, audience reach, and marketing tools. Don't be afraid to experiment and adjust your strategy based on data.

Another critical aspect is crafting a compelling artist brand. Create a unique online presence that showcases your musical style, personality, and story. Engage with fans through social media, build an email list, and evaluate live streaming performances to foster a loyal following.

Remember, success in music distribution is a ongoing journey. Stay informed about industry trends, adapt with the times, and never stop making music that resonates with your audience.
